– Adherence towards ethical standards
1. Real estate agents must adhere to high ethical standards to protect their reputation and act in the interests of clients.
2. California Department of Real Estate has set out guidelines for real estate agents. These guidelines outline the ethical standards and practices agents are expected to follow.
3. In California, honesty and transparency is a key standard for all real estate agents. This applies to dealings with clients and colleagues as well as the public. Agents must provide accurate and truthful information to clients and disclose any relevant information that may impact a transaction.
4. Another important ethical standard is confidentiality. Real estate agents should protect the confidential information of their customers, including financial and personal information. They must also not divulge sensitive data without permission.
5. Real estate agents in California must also avoid conflicts of interests and act in a professional, unbiased way when representing their clients. Agents should avoid any activity that might compromise their ability to act for their clients’ best interest.
6. It is equally important that real estate agents respect the rights and dignity all parties involved in any transaction and treat them with fairness and integrity. Discrimination in any form is strictly prohibited and agents must conduct themselves in a manner that promotes diversity and inclusivity.
7. In conclusion, adherence of ethical standards is crucial for real estate agent in California to maintain trust and confidence from their clients and the general public. By upholding the standards, agents can ensure their long-term career success and build a good reputation in the field.

9. Tech-savvy
– Proficiency with real estate technology
California real estate agents must be able to use real estate technology. With the advancement of technology, agents must be well-versed in various platforms and tools to effectively market properties and assist clients in buying or selling homes.
Customer relationship management software (CRM) is an important aspect of real-estate technology. It keeps track of client interactions and preferences, as well as properties. This allows agents the ability to personalize services and offer a more tailored service for each client.
In addition, real estate agents in California must be proficient in using multiple listing services (MLS) to access and list properties on the market. These platforms help agents reach a broader audience of buyers and streamline their process of finding and listing properties.
In addition, the real estate sector is increasingly reliant on agents who are familiar with virtual reality (VR) tours and 3D technology. Agents that can create immersive virtual tour of properties can attract buyers and showcase the homes in a unique, engaging way.
Real estate agents in California need to be adept at social media and online marketing. Knowing how to use social media platforms such as Facebook, Instagram, or Twitter to promote listings and to connect with clients gives agents an edge in the marketplace.
In conclusion, California real estate agents need to be proficient with the latest technology in order to compete in a highly competitive market. Agents can achieve greater success by staying current on the latest tools, platforms and technologies.
